In usb_modeswitch Makefile dispatcher-script, dispatcher-dynlink and
dispatcher-statlink are .PHONY targets. The result is that sources are compiled
also when install targets are called. USB_MODESWITCH_INSTALL_TARGET_CMDS calls
$(MAKE) which is a call to parallel make eg. make -j9. So the install phase can
install empty usb_modeswitch binary (happened once) if the compiler have just
cleared the binary and install command installs it before compiler writes the
binary. USB_MODESWITCH_INSTALL_TARGET_CMDS should call $(MAKE1).
